
If your Drupal website slows down, crashes, or behaves unpredictably every time traffic spikes, you’re not alone. Many high-traffic Drupal sites fail not because of poor development, but due to weak DevOps practices. When thousands—or even millions—of users hit your site simultaneously, every deployment, cache clear, or server hiccup becomes a risk. That’s where a well-planned Drupal DevOps strategy steps in, helping teams deliver speed, stability, and scalability without constant firefighting.
High-traffic Drupal websites are dynamic ecosystems. Content updates, module changes, security patches, and marketing campaigns all happen frequently. Without DevOps alignment, these moving parts can clash—leading to downtime or performance drops. DevOps bridges the gap between development and operations, ensuring faster releases, predictable environments, and minimal disruption for end users.
A mature Drupal DevOps approach isn’t about tools alone; it’s about consistency, automation, and proactive monitoring.
High-traffic Drupal websites demand infrastructure that scales horizontally. Instead of relying on a single powerful server, distribute workloads across multiple instances. Load balancers, containerized environments, and cloud-based infrastructure allow Drupal to handle traffic surges without breaking.
Choose hosting environments optimized for Drupal, and ensure your architecture supports easy scaling during campaigns, product launches, or viral moments.
Manual server configuration increases risk. Infrastructure automation ensures consistency across development, staging, and production environments. When environments behave the same way, deployments become safer and debugging becomes faster—especially crucial when traffic volumes are high.
Continuous Integration and Continuous Deployment (CI/CD) is the backbone of modern Drupal DevOps. Automated testing, code reviews, and controlled releases reduce human error and allow frequent, smaller updates instead of risky big launches.
For high-traffic Drupal websites, this means zero-downtime deployments and faster rollback options when something goes wrong.
A clean Drupal deployment strategy separates code from configuration and content. This ensures that updates don’t overwrite live data or break site behavior. Configuration management allows teams to push changes confidently while keeping production content safe.
Drupal caching is non-negotiable for high-traffic environments. Page caching, dynamic page caching, and reverse proxies dramatically reduce server load. When caching is correctly configured, Drupal serves more users with fewer resources.
Beyond Drupal’s built-in options, external caching layers can help absorb traffic spikes and keep response times fast.
High-traffic Drupal websites suffer when databases become bottlenecks. Regular database optimization, query reviews, and proper indexing go a long way. Similarly, optimized images, compressed assets, and efficient frontend delivery help improve user experience and SEO performance.
Monitoring is not optional in Drupal DevOps—it’s your early warning system. Track server health, response times, error rates, and traffic patterns continuously. When anomalies appear, teams can act before users notice.
For high-traffic websites, proactive monitoring often means the difference between a minor slowdown and a full outage.
Centralized logging makes troubleshooting faster and more reliable. When something breaks during peak traffic, clear logs help identify whether the issue lies in code, infrastructure, or third-party services.
Drupal is known for strong security practices, but only if updates are applied on time. DevOps automation helps schedule and deploy security patches safely, reducing exposure without interrupting users.
For high-traffic Drupal websites, delayed updates can quickly turn into serious vulnerabilities.
Restrict access to production environments and apply strict permission controls. DevOps workflows ensure that only tested and approved changes reach live users, maintaining both security and stability.
Even the best systems fail occasionally. A strong Drupal DevOps setup includes automated backups and tested recovery plans. When traffic is high, recovery time matters—minutes of downtime can mean significant revenue or reputation loss.
Every deployment should have a rollback plan. High-traffic Drupal websites benefit from redundant systems that keep the site online even when individual components fail.
DevOps is as much about culture as it is about tools. When developers, operations, and content teams collaborate early, deployments become smoother and risks decrease. Clear ownership and shared responsibility help teams respond quickly during traffic spikes.
Standard operating procedures reduce confusion during high-pressure situations. Documented workflows ensure that everyone knows how deployments, updates, and incident responses should happen—especially critical for large Drupal projects.
When managing high-traffic Drupal websites, having a clear DevOps checklist helps teams stay proactive rather than reactive. These best practices act as guardrails, ensuring performance and stability even during peak usage.
This checklist helps DevOps teams maintain reliability while supporting growth. For high-traffic Drupal websites, consistency and preparation are the real performance multipliers.
Drupal DevOps best practices are no longer optional for high-traffic websites—they are essential. From scalable infrastructure and automated deployments to performance optimization and proactive monitoring, DevOps ensures your Drupal site remains fast, secure, and reliable even under intense demand.
When done right, DevOps doesn’t just prevent problems; it empowers teams to innovate faster and deliver better digital experiences. Investing in a strong Drupal DevOps strategy today means fewer emergencies tomorrow—and a website that grows confidently alongside your audience.
© 2025 Crivva - Hosted by Airy Hosting Managed Website Hosting.